meaning behind Caring. Connecting. Growing together. Primary
Responsibilities: The Nurse Manager is accountable for planning and
oversight of department staff activities related to patient care,
ensuring customer satisfaction and adherence to fiscal budget,
policies, procedures, standards and regulations He or she works
collaboratively with others at all levels of the organization to
create an environment of excellence, trust, and continual learning
Must be informed and maintain generalist nursing skill
proficiency/competency in all aspects of clinical nurse
responsibilities in an outpatient setting Scope of responsibility
will include oversight of a disease specific or patient population
management program in multiple Departments and/or a high degree of
patient complexity and/or multiple locations, with executive
